#a3396e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a3396e is composed of 63.9% red, 22.4% green and 43.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 65% magenta, 32.5% yellow and 36.1% black. It has a hue angle of 330 degrees, a saturation of 48.2% and a lightness of 43.1%. #a3396e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ff72dc with #470000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

● #a3396e color description : Dark moderate pink.
#a3396e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a3396e has RGB values of R:163, G:57, B:110 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.65, Y:0.33,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 10697070.
